ZClass AttributeError: catalog_object

3 messages Options
Embed this post
Permalink
Alwin M. Schronen

ZClass AttributeError: catalog_object

Reply Threaded More More options
Print post
Permalink
Hallo,

ich habe eine Seite von Zope 2.8.8-final auf Zope 2.9.8-final umgezogen.
Die Seite hat einen Inhaltstyp, den ich per ZClass definiert habe.

Die ZClass beinhaltet folgende Base Classes: ZObject, CatalogAwareBase, ZObjectManager.

Wenn ich nun ein neus Object dieser ZClasse hinzufügen will, gibt es einen AttributeError: catalog_object.

Hat jemand eine Idee?
Dank!

Alwin


Traceback (innermost last):
  Module ZPublisher.Publish, line 115, in publish
  Module ZPublisher.mapply, line 88, in mapply
  Module ZPublisher.Publish, line 41, in call_object
  Module Shared.DC.Scripts.Bindings, line 311, in __call__
  Module Shared.DC.Scripts.Bindings, line 348, in _bindAndExec
  Module Products.PythonScripts.PythonScript, line 326, in _exec
  Module None, line 3, in ASWerk_add
   - <PythonScript at /as/DB/SBMP/ASWerk_add used for /as/DB/SBMP/ASWerk_factory>
   - Line 3
  Module ZClasses.ZClass, line 464, in createInObjectManager
  Module OFS.ObjectManager, line 333, in _setObject
  Module zope.event, line 23, in notify
  Module zope.app.event.dispatching, line 66, in dispatch
  Module zope.component, line 181, in subscribers
  Module zope.component.site, line 89, in subscribers
  Module zope.interface.adapter, line 481, in subscribers
  Module zope.app.event.objectevent, line 192, in objectEventNotify
  Module zope.component, line 181, in subscribers
  Module zope.component.site, line 89, in subscribers
  Module zope.interface.adapter, line 481, in subscribers
  Module OFS.subscribers, line 114, in dispatchObjectMovedEvent
  Module OFS.subscribers, line 144, in callManageAfterAdd
  Module Products.ZCatalog.CatalogAwareness, line 47, in manage_afterAdd
  Module Products.ZCatalog.CatalogAwareness, line 117, in index_object
AttributeError: catalog_object

--
Alwin Michael Schronen
Kirchenmusiker

Grumbachtalweg 13
D - 66121 Saarbrücken

Tel.  +49 681 754 00 91
Mobil +49 177 5453 423

[hidden email]




_______________________________________________
zope mailing list
[hidden email]
https://mail.dzug.org/mailman/listinfo/zope
Alwin M. Schronen

Re: ZClass AttributeError: catalog_object

Reply Threaded More More options
Print post
Permalink
Alwin Michael SCHRONEN schrieb:
> ich habe eine Seite von Zope 2.8.8-final auf Zope 2.9.8-final umgezogen.
> Die Seite hat einen Inhaltstyp, den ich per ZClass definiert habe.
> Die ZClass beinhaltet folgende Base Classes: ZObject,
> CatalogAwareBase, ZObjectManager.
> Wenn ich nun ein neus Object dieser ZClasse hinzufügen will, gibt es
> einen AttributeError: catalog_object.
>
Ich habe die alte ZClass gelöscht und neu gebaut, das Problem bleibt.

Wenn ich mich nun von der ZClass verabschiede und ein Product auf dem
Filesystem baue
mit dem selben Metatype und den gleichen Eigenschaften, kann ich dann
mit den Instanzen
der alten ZClass weiterarbeiten???

Gruß
Alwin

--
Alwin Michael Schronen
Kirchenmusiker

Grumbachtalweg 13
D - 66121 Saarbrücken

Tel.  +49 681 754 00 91
Mobil +49 177 5453 423

[hidden email]




_______________________________________________
zope mailing list
[hidden email]
https://mail.dzug.org/mailman/listinfo/zope
robert rottermann

Re: ZClass AttributeError: catalog_object

Reply Threaded More More options
Print post
Permalink
ich kann dir deine frage nicht beantworten, weil ich nie ernsthaft mit zklassen
gearbeitet habe.

aber:
wenn du dir die mühe machst ein produkt für die alten zklassen zu erstellen,
dann mach doch gleich ein script, dass betehende konvertiert.

sonst hast du garantiert permanennt ärger mit etwas das doch nicht ganz
funktioniert, und von niemandem mehr ernsthaft angeschaut wird.

robert


Alwin Michael SCHRONEN schrieb:

> Alwin Michael SCHRONEN schrieb:
>> ich habe eine Seite von Zope 2.8.8-final auf Zope 2.9.8-final umgezogen.
>> Die Seite hat einen Inhaltstyp, den ich per ZClass definiert habe.
>> Die ZClass beinhaltet folgende Base Classes: ZObject,
>> CatalogAwareBase, ZObjectManager.
>> Wenn ich nun ein neus Object dieser ZClasse hinzufügen will, gibt es
>> einen AttributeError: catalog_object.
>>
> Ich habe die alte ZClass gelöscht und neu gebaut, das Problem bleibt.
>
> Wenn ich mich nun von der ZClass verabschiede und ein Product auf dem
> Filesystem baue
> mit dem selben Metatype und den gleichen Eigenschaften, kann ich dann
> mit den Instanzen
> der alten ZClass weiterarbeiten???
>
> Gruß
> Alwin
>
>
> ------------------------------------------------------------------------
>
>
>
> _______________________________________________
> zope mailing list
> [hidden email]
> https://mail.dzug.org/mailman/listinfo/zope



_______________________________________________
zope mailing list
[hidden email]
https://mail.dzug.org/mailman/listinfo/zope